The Fidelity Funds - European Dividend Fund (A-ACC-Euro) seeks to provide a combination of income and long-term capital growth by investing primarily in dividend-paying equity securities of companies having their registered office in Europe or exercising a predominant part of their economic activity there.
Investment Objective
This fund focuses on European companies with strong, sustainable dividend yields. European equities have historically offered higher dividend yields than their US counterparts, making Europe an attractive hunting ground for income-oriented equity investors.
European Dividend Culture
Many European companies, particularly in financials, utilities, consumer staples, and healthcare, have strong traditions of returning capital to shareholders through dividends. The UK, Germany, France, Switzerland, and Scandinavia are home to many globally recognized dividend-paying companies.
Accumulating Share Class
Despite being a dividend-focused strategy, this ACC share class reinvests all income back into the fund. This provides compound growth for long-term investors who do not need current income distributions.
Quality Screen
Dividend funds typically favour companies with:
- Consistent earnings and cash flow generation
- Conservative balance sheets
- Long track records of dividend payment and growth
- Competitive moats in their respective industries
Currency
Denominated in Euro, eliminating currency costs for Eurozone investors.
Risk Considerations
Dividend cuts during economic downturns, sector concentration in financials and utilities, and broader European macroeconomic risks are key considerations.
